    What is AHIP certification

    Any one who is either in Medicare sales or considering adding them to their current business will ask the question:  What is AHIP certification.

    First, let us explain who AHIP is:

    AHIP is the most proactive health care association in our nation.  They have representatives in every state capital and are up to date on all the latest health industry information/changes.  They provide health related information and coverage for hundreds of millions of people in America.  Their main job is to improve and protect the consumer’s health and financial security.  AHIP is committed to market-based solutions and partnerships that improve the well-being of consumers. AHIP’s  goal is to make sure consumers have the best health care options as well as an affordable rate.

    Second, what is AHIP certification:

    AHIP certification is an industry wide, accepted method that proves that you both understand and are ready to sell Medicare according to CMS regulations. This procedure is in place to protect the rights of the consumer.

    Almost every Medicare Advantage as well as Prescription Drug Plan Carrier requires you to pass AHIP in order to be appointed to sell.  Once you pass the AHIP test, you must still complete carrier specific certifications.

    Third, preparing for the exam:

    It is best to study each module of the AHIP course very carefully. Pay close attention to the practice questions; you may see them on your exam.  It is the goal of AHIP to ensure that anyone who sells Medicare can pass the exam.

    You can take AHIP training either directly from the AHIP site for a cost of $175 or you can take the course from one of the major carrier’s.  If you decide to take it from a carrier’s site, the cost is lowered to $125.

    As of June 23, 2020, you must complete ALL review questions before you can start the next training module.  This way you can be sure you understand each section before moving on to the next module.  Please use these questions to help you focus on areas where you need more time to study.  You can use the review questions as many times as you like and the answers do not count toward your AHIP  final exam grade.  Course guide available here

    What is AHIP Certification Tips:

    • Many of the review questions are the exact same questions on the 50 question test.  Make sure you know all the review questions and answers well.  More than half of the test questions will be almost identical to the review questions.
    • Remember to complete the FWA training and test after you have passed the Medicare portion of the AHIP exam
    • You do not need AHIP to sell Medicare supplements plans
    • Most MAPD, MA and PDP plans require you to take and pass AHIP in order to offer their plans. UHC is an exception to this.

    Finally, about the exam:

    This is an online exam.  There are 50 questions to answer and it is an open book test with a 2 hour time limit. The test consists of 2 parts and you must pass both in order to be AHIP certified.  Each participant has 3 attempts to pass the test.  You can purchase an additional 3 tries, although many carriers will not allow you to sell their products for the year if you don’t pass by the third attempt.
